What is Top Fuel Drag Racing?
So, what exactly is Top Fuel Drag Racing? Simply put, it's the quickest and fastest category in the world of drag racing. We're talking about machines that can cover a 1,000-foot track in under four seconds, reaching speeds of over 330 mph! These aren't your average souped-up cars; they are purpose-built, nitro-burning monsters engineered for one thing: raw, unadulterated speed. The engines produce upwards of 11,000 horsepower, making them some of the most powerful internal combustion engines on the planet. To put that in perspective, that's like having about ten Bugatti Veyrons strapped together!
These dragsters use a special blend of nitromethane and methanol as fuel, which creates a mind-blowing explosion in the cylinders. When these engines fire up, the ground shakes, and you can feel the vibrations in your chest. It’s an experience that assaults all your senses in the best possible way. The races are short and intense, typically lasting only a few seconds, but the sheer spectacle of it all is something you won't forget anytime soon. Top Fuel Drag Racing is more than just a sport; it's a demonstration of extreme engineering and human skill, pushing the boundaries of what’s possible on four wheels.

Key Components of a Top Fuel Dragster
Let’s break down what makes these Top Fuel dragsters so incredibly fast and powerful. It's not just about a big engine; it's a symphony of engineering working together in perfect harmony.
The Engine
The heart of a Top Fuel dragster is its engine. Typically, these are supercharged, 500-cubic-inch (8.2-liter) Hemi engines. But don't let the seemingly simple design fool you; these engines are highly specialized and built to withstand enormous stress. The supercharger, often a roots-type blower, forces massive amounts of air into the cylinders, allowing for more fuel to be burned. This results in an explosive combustion that generates unbelievable power. The engine block is usually made from billet aluminum to handle the intense pressures, and components are constantly being upgraded and refined to squeeze out every last bit of horsepower.
The Fuel System
As mentioned earlier, Top Fuel dragsters run on a mixture of nitromethane and methanol. Nitromethane is an incredibly volatile substance that contains oxygen within its molecular structure, meaning it doesn't need to rely solely on atmospheric oxygen for combustion. This allows for a much larger fuel charge to be burned, resulting in a massive increase in power. During a typical Top Fuel run, a dragster can consume as much as 15 gallons of fuel! The fuel system is meticulously calibrated to ensure the perfect air-fuel ratio, as even slight imbalances can lead to catastrophic engine failure.
The Chassis and Aerodynamics
The chassis of a Top Fuel dragster is a long, narrow tube frame designed for strength and stability. It needs to withstand the immense forces generated during acceleration and deceleration. Aerodynamics also play a crucial role. The long wheelbase and rear wing help to keep the car stable and prevent it from lifting off the ground at high speeds. The front wing, or canard, is designed to create downforce and improve steering. Every aspect of the chassis and bodywork is carefully engineered to minimize drag and maximize performance.
The Tires
The tires on a Top Fuel dragster are another critical component. They are massive, specially designed slicks that provide maximum traction. These tires are inflated to very low pressures, typically around 7-8 psi, to increase the contact patch with the track surface. During a run, the tires deform dramatically, creating a characteristic wrinkle in the sidewall. This wrinkling helps to absorb some of the shock from the initial launch and provides additional grip. The tires are subjected to incredible forces and temperatures, and they are typically only good for a few runs before needing to be replaced.
